ГОСТ Р ИСО/МЭК МФС 11185-10-99
Идентифицированное локальное событие, которое формирует это СВГ1. является сигнальным
событием, имеющим единственный целочисленный параметр; см. 3.4.12. Само сигнальное событие
может быть сформировано устройством обновления обьекта или функцией обработки событий в
качестве РВП. Если оно формируется устройством обновления объекта, то устройство предостав
ляет значение параметра, а соответствующим полем является поле, если оно имеется, в котором
в настоящее время находится логическое местоположение ввода; см. 3.3.7. Если оно формируется
функцией обработки событий, то соответствующая РВП определяет и значение параметра, и
связанное с ним поле. РВП этого ОУМВП допускает формирование сигнального события,
но событие должно быть сформировано в соответствии с семантикой других присутствующих
в КОВ ОУМВП.
П р и м е ч а н и е —Формирование сигнального события устройством обновлении объект может, на
пример. соответствовать лсйствию одного из множества числовых функциональных кодов.
СВП формируется для конкретного поля некоторым сигнальным событием, связанным с
таким полем, значение целочисленного параметра которого лежит в множестве, указанном значе
нием параметра СВП.
Когда формируется СВП. целочисленное значение параметра инициирующего сигнального
события запоминается в области текущего сигнала до выполнения последующей обработки ЗМВГ1;
см. 3.4.2.
Если результатом ЗМВП с этим СВП является завершение ввода данных, координаты поля,
которые должны быть даны в обновлении объекта управления контекстом (ОУК) в соответствии с
12.6.2.2, зависят от того, кем была активизирована ЗМВП —устройством обновления объекта или
функцией обработки событий. Если она была активизирована устройством обновления объекта, то
координаты паля содержатся в логическом местоположении ввода во время формирования этого
СВП. Если ЗМВП была активизирована функцией обработки событий, то завершение относится к
результату из ЗМВП, РВП которой сформировали сигнальное событие, и координаты поля в
результате определяются СВП этой ЗМВП.
12.4.2 Ввод в поле завершен
Данное СВП может быть сформировано только для свободного поля; см. 3.4.5. Это СВП не
имеет параметров. Оно формируется для определенного поля, когда локальная функция обработки
принимает обновление для значения первичного атрибута последнего элемента массива этого поля.
Прим с манне —Это СВП нс предполагает, что все другие элементы массива ноля имеют присвоен
ные первичные атрибуты.
Если результатом ЗМВП с этим СВГ1 яаляется завершение ввода данных, координаты поля,
которые должны быть даны в обновлении ОУК в соответствии с 12.6.2.2, являются координатами
последнего элемента массива соответствующего поля.
12.4.3 Пазе выбрано
Данное СВП может быть сформировано только для выбираемого поля; см. 3.4.11. Это СВП
не имеет параметров. Оно формируется для конкретного поля, когда значение переменной
состояния для этого поля изменяется из «не выбрано» в «выбрано».
Если результатом ЗМВП с этим СВП яаляется завершение ввода данных, координаты поля,
которые должны быть даны в обновлении ОУК в соответствии с 12.6.2.2, являются координатами
последнего элемента массива соответствующего патя.
П р и мс ч а и и е —В этом случае координата к, данная в обновлении ОУК. не несет информации, но
это значение должно быть указано как обязательный параметр обновления.
12.4.4 Отмена выбора поля
Данное СВП может быть сформировано только для выбираемого поля; см. 3.4.11. Это СВП
не имеет параметров. Оно формируется дтя конкретного поля, когда значение переменной
состояния для этого поля изменяется из «выбрано* в «не выбрано».
Если результатом ЗМВП с этим СВП яаляется завершение ввода данных, координаты поля,
которые должны быть дамы в обновлении ОУК в соответствии с 12.6.2.2, являются координатами
первого элемента массива соответствующего поля.
П р и м е ч а н и е —В этом случае координата
к,
данная в обновлении ОУК. нс несет информации, но
это значение должно быть указано как обязательный параметр обновления.
12.4.5 Время ожидания поля закопчено
Данное СВП может быть сформировано только дтя поля, которое имеет определенное время
ожидания поля; см. 3.4.4. Это СВП не имеет параметров. Оно формируется для конкретного паля
при окончании таймера с обратным отсчетом дтя этого поля, если логическое местоположение
ввода адресует один и тот же элемент массива этого поля.
14